Section 03B .0704 - REQUIREMENTS FOR THIRD PARTY EXAMINERS
(a) Third Party Examiners may conduct skills tests on behalf of only one Third Party Tester at any given time. If a Third Party Examiner leaves the employ of a Third Party Tester he or she must reapply to conduct tests on behalf of a new Third Party Tester.
(b) To qualify as a Third Party Examiner, an individual must:
(1) apply on a form provided and sent to the applicant via email by the Division as set forth in Rule .0707 of this Section;
(2) be a payroll employee of the Third Party Tester;
(3) possess a valid North Carolina Driver's License with classification and endorsements required for operation of the class and type of commercial motor vehicle used in the skills tests conducted by the Examiner;
(4) have completed the Third Party Examiner CDL Training Course conducted by the Division. At a minimum upon completion of the training the Third Party Examiner shall have acquired and demonstrated the following knowledge and skills:
(A) understanding of G.S. 20 Article 2C and the rules adopted pursuant thereto;
(B) knowledge of the CDL testing procedures and forms;
(C) ability to administer and complete all forms without errors for the CDL skills test; and
(D) knowledge of testing site and route requirements.
(5) take part in all Division required advanced training courses, workshops and seminars;
(6) within 10 years prior to application have had no convictions for Driving While Impaired (DWI);
(7) within five years prior to application have had no driver's license suspensions, revocations, cancellations, or disqualifications;
(8) be at least 21 years of age; and
(9) conduct skills tests on behalf of the Third Party Tester, in accordance with these Rules and in accordance with current instructions provided by the Division.
